ARD - Lucky Posted July 1, 2012 Report Share Posted July 1, 2012 Did quite a bit of testing Friday and Saturday, I'll keep the results more brief since not all M44 conversions are affected. Short answer is if you find your ECU is not entering closed loop (i.e. STFT sitting at 0 and not moving) then I have the fix for you! Simple error in the coding but it's an easy enough fix. Recieved ARD's revised tune today. After about 60 miles of driving and five or so restarts, Lucky has it all sorted out. Car goes into closed loop, fuel trims change as they should and EVAP seems to be working as it should. I'm sure it's just in my head, but car seems to run better...
